What is the difference between Sports Program Coordinator vs Sports Event Organizer?

AspectSports Program CoordinatorSports Event Organizer
CredentialsRelevant certifications (e.g., CPR, coaching certifications)Event planning experience, certifications optional
Work EnvironmentSports facilities, schools, community centersEvent venues, outdoor and indoor locations
Employer & IndustrySports organizations, schools, community programsEvent management companies, sports leagues
Primary FocusManaging ongoing sports programs and activitiesPlanning and executing specific sports events

While both roles involve sports and event management, the Sports Program Coordinator focuses on managing regular sports programs, whereas the Sports Event Organizer specializes in planning and executing individual sports events. What does a sports program coordinator do?

A Sports Program Coordinator is responsible for planning, organizing, and overseeing sports programs and activities for organizations such as schools, community centers, or recreational facilities. Their duties typically include scheduling events, managing budgets, coordinating with coaches and staff, and ensuring that programs run smoothly and safely. They also promote participation, handle registrations, and may be involved in hiring and training staff. The goal is to provide enjoyable and effective sports experiences for participants of all ages and skill levels.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a sports program coordinator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Sports Program Coordinator, you need strong organizational abilities, knowledge of sports management, and typically a degree in recreation, sports administration, or a related field. Familiarity with event management software, scheduling tools, and basic budgeting systems is often required. Excellent communication, leadership, and conflict-resolution skills help foster positive interactions with staff, participants, and stakeholders. These skills and qualities are essential for smoothly running sports programs, ensuring participant satisfaction, and achieving organizational goals.

What are some common challenges faced by sports program coordinators and how can they be managed?

Sports Program Coordinators often encounter challenges such as balancing the needs and preferences of diverse participant groups, managing scheduling conflicts, and ensuring compliance with safety regulations. Effective communication and strong organizational skills are vital for handling these situations. Coordinators typically work closely with coaches, volunteers, and facility staff to resolve issues quickly, adapt to last-minute changes, and maintain a positive experience for all participants. Proactive planning and regular feedback from stakeholders can also help in minimizing these challenges.

Founded in Tampa, Florida i9 Sports® is the nation's first and largest youth sports league franchise business in the United States with over 1 million registrations in more than 500 communities from New York to Hawaii. Established in 2003 by Frank Fiume on the principle that the number one reason kids play organized sports is to have fun, not to become the next draft pick. i9 Sports offers youth sports leagues, camps, and clinics for kids ages 3-17 in today's most popular sports such as flag football, soccer, basketball, volleyball, and baseball.
